What is SikuliX?

SikuliX is an open-source tool used for automating graphical user interfaces (GUIs) using images. It uses image recognition to identify and control GUI elements, making it a powerful tool for automating tasks in various fields, including e-commerce, gaming, and more. SikuliX is a Java-based tool that can be used on Windows, macOS, and Linux platforms.

Main Features

SikuliX has several key features that make it a popular choice for automation tasks:

  • Image recognition: SikuliX uses image recognition to identify GUI elements, allowing for precise control over the automation process.
  • Multi-platform support: SikuliX can run on Windows, macOS, and Linux platforms, making it a versatile tool for automating tasks across different operating systems.
  • Scripting support: SikuliX supports scripting in various languages, including Java, Python, and Ruby, making it easy to integrate with existing automation frameworks.

Installation Guide

Step 1: Download SikuliX

To get started with SikuliX, download the latest version from the official website. SikuliX is available for free, and the download process is straightforward.

Step 2: Install SikuliX

Once the download is complete, run the installer and follow the prompts to install SikuliX on your system. The installation process is relatively quick and easy.

Step 3: Launch SikuliX

After installation, launch SikuliX by double-clicking on the icon or by running the command-line interface. This will open the SikuliX IDE, where you can start creating your automation scripts.

Backup Snapshot Playbook Guide

Creating a Backup Snapshot

To create a backup snapshot in SikuliX, follow these steps:

  1. Open the SikuliX IDE and navigate to the project you want to backup.
  2. Click on the

Submit your application